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
053 4042 122 43811372 3012
7527635 23
7527635 23
750 70 5820964
All about undefined
Interested in learning more?
7527635 23
750 70 5820964
See more
8232128 777 440
598 8344623 16751 224486036
See more
39893435894 2998870
77 672276305 33335140
See more